首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BehaviorSubject不允许在订阅后将数据存储在数组中

BehaviorSubject是RxJS库中的一个特殊类型的可观察对象(Observable),它具有以下特点:

概念: BehaviorSubject是一种特殊的Subject,它是一种可观察对象,可以用来表示一个值或事件流,并且可以被多个观察者订阅。与普通的Subject不同的是,BehaviorSubject在被订阅时会立即发送最新的值给观察者。

分类: BehaviorSubject属于RxJS库中的Subject类型,Subject是一种特殊的可观察对象,既可以作为观察者,也可以作为被观察者。

优势:

  1. BehaviorSubject可以保存并提供最新的值给新的订阅者,这对于需要获取当前值的场景非常有用。
  2. BehaviorSubject具有Subject的所有特性,可以作为观察者接收其他Observable的值,并且可以作为被观察者向其他观察者发送值。

应用场景:

  1. 在状态管理中,可以使用BehaviorSubject来保存和共享应用程序的状态,并在状态发生变化时通知订阅者。
  2. 在表单处理中,可以使用BehaviorSubject来保存表单字段的值,并在值发生变化时通知其他组件或服务。

推荐的腾讯云相关产品: 腾讯云提供了云原生应用引擎(Cloud Native Application Engine,CNAE)产品,它是一个全托管的容器化应用引擎,可以帮助开发者快速构建、部署和管理云原生应用。CNAE支持多种编程语言和框架,包括前端开发、后端开发、数据库等。在使用BehaviorSubject时,可以将CNAE作为后端服务来存储和管理数据。

产品介绍链接地址: 腾讯云云原生应用引擎(CNAE):https://cloud.tencent.com/product/cnae

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券